1. Ingredients
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- Salt and black pepper to taste
For the Bruschetta Topping
- 3 medium tomatoes,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- ¼ cup fresh basil, chopped
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
- Salt and black pepper to taste
For Garnish
- Balsamic glaze (store-bought or homemade)
- Fresh basil leaves
2. Preparation Time
- Prep time: 10 minutes
- Cook time: 20 minutes
- Total time: 30 minutes
3. Serving Quantity
- Serves 4
4.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Brush chicken breasts with olive oil and season with gar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and sear chicken for 2–3 minutes per side until golden.
- Transfer to a baking dish and bake for 15–18 minutes or until fully cooked.
- In a bowl, combine diced tomatoes, garlic, basil, olive oil, balsamic vinegar, salt, and pepper. Toss well.
- Spoon the tomato mixture over each chicken breast.
- Drizzle with balsamic glaze and garnish with fresh basil.

6. Tips
- Use cherry tomatoes for a sweeter topping.
- For extra flavor, add shredded mozzarella or parmesan before baking.
- Serve with garlic bread or a green salad for a complete meal.
